The NHL has just announced the three finalists for the Jack Adams Award and Colorado Avalanche head coach Jared Bednar is among them. The Coach of the Year award will be handed out at the NHL awards on June 20.
The Jack Adams Award is voted on by the National Hockey League Broadcasters’ Association and is given out yearly to the coach who “adjudged to have contributed the most to his team’s success.”
The three finalists for this year’s award are:
Jared Bednar - Colorado Avalanche - 43-30-9
Gerard Gallant - Vegas Golden Knights - 51-24-7
Bruce Cassidy - Boston Bruins - 50-20-12
With the way the Vegas Golden Knights took the league by storm this year, One would assume that Gerard Gallant is the front runner to win the award, but a strong case can be made for Bednar. After suffering through a nightmare of a first season as an NHL head coach - his only losing season as a professional head coach, Bednar led the Avalanche to one of the biggest improvements in NHL history this year. The Avalanche fell one win shy of doubling their win total from the 2016-17 season. A 47-point improvement saw Colorado make the playoffs in a year when most projection had them finishing in the bottom-5 of the league.
Bednar is finishing up his second season as a head coach in the NHL after replacing Patrick Roy in the summer of 2016. Prior to joining the Avalanche, he led the Lake Erie Monsters to the Calder Cup.
